Katie Price recently opened up about her approach to life amid jail warrant threats.

As fans will know, Katie failed to appear for a court hearing over tax evasion.

In response to her absence, a barrister reportedly said to the High Court judge, "It's quite apparent that the evidence was filed very late and not even filed with the court,” as per the findings of The U.S Sun. 

“We are in a very serious situation as a consequence. She may be held in contempt of court, imprisoned, fined or a warrant issued for her arrest,” they threatened.

Following this declaration, Katie posted a video of herself in order to promote her latest autobiography and claimed, "I've learned not to be afraid."

"This book just tops all the others. For so many years I hide behind what I've learned the mask because that's my way to deal with things. And it gets to a point where it becomes noise," she said of her upcoming memoir.

The alleged bankrupt TV personality also shared with her fans, "I had my breakdown, the worst thing ever. And now I've come on top I've learned not to be afraid. And I think in this book people get to see really what it's like to be me.”

She went on to reveal, “There will be uplifting moments, dark moments, moments where I can put the truth right with a lot of things,” announcing, "She's got her next book out," and the clip ended.
